Top Tips for Choosing the Best Photos for Face Swapping

When preparing photos for a face swap, it's essential to select images that have the right quality and characteristics to ensure the best results. A successful face swap depends largely on factors such as lighting, angle, and resolution. Poor photo quality can result in unrealistic or awkward outcomes, so understanding how to choose the ideal images is crucial. Below are some practical tips that will help you achieve more seamless face-swapping results.

One of the key elements to consider when choosing photos is the alignment of facial features. Proper alignment makes the face-swapping process smoother and leads to more natural-looking results. Make sure the face in the photo is clearly visible, with minimal distractions in the background or unnecessary elements obstructing the view.

Key Considerations for Selecting Photos

  • Resolution: Choose high-resolution images to avoid pixelation during the swap process.
  • Lighting: Natural lighting or soft, even light is ideal. Avoid harsh shadows or overexposure.
  • Facial Visibility: Ensure the face is fully visible, without obstructive elements like hats or sunglasses.
  • Angle: The face should be facing the camera or at a similar angle to the face you are swapping with.

What to Avoid

  1. Blurred Images: Avoid blurry images, as they make it difficult for the software to accurately capture facial features.
  2. Too Many Faces: If the image has multiple people, ensure the face you want to swap is the focus of the photo.
  3. Extreme Angles: Avoid images with extreme angles, such as very high or low shots, as they distort facial features.

Legal and Ethical Considerations in Face-Swapping Technology

The rise of face-swapping technology has sparked important conversations about its legal and ethical implications. As this technology advances, it raises numerous questions about personal rights, privacy, and the potential for misuse. In the absence of clear regulations, both creators and users must navigate complex issues regarding consent, intellectual property, and the authenticity of digital content.

While face-swapping technology can be used for entertainment, marketing, and other creative purposes, it can also pose significant risks. Deepfakes and manipulated content have been used to deceive individuals, damage reputations, or spread misinformation. Thus, it is crucial to understand the boundaries that define acceptable use and avoid exploiting the technology in harmful or deceptive ways.

Legal Issues to Consider

  • Intellectual Property Rights: Using someone's likeness without permission can infringe on their personal rights and potentially violate copyright laws if the person’s image is trademarked.
  • Consent: Using an individual's face in a digital swap without their consent can be a violation of their privacy and rights, leading to legal action in some jurisdictions.
  • Defamation and Reputation Damage: Malicious use of face-swapping technology can damage a person’s reputation, opening the door for defamation lawsuits.

Ethical Considerations

  1. Respect for Individual Autonomy: It is essential to obtain consent before altering someone’s image, as unauthorized use can undermine their autonomy and personal dignity.
  2. Impact on Trust: Manipulated media can erode public trust, especially in news and political contexts. Authenticity becomes compromised when it becomes difficult to discern real from altered content.
  3. Accountability: Those who create or share face-swapped content should be held accountable for its impact, particularly if the content misleads, harms, or manipulates the audience.
